Clement Mok (co-chair) is a self-described “media agnostic” who creates meaningful connections between people, ideas, art, and technology through his many design and consulting projects — everything from cyberspace theme parks and expert publishing systems to major identity programs. Currently chairman and information architect of Studio Archetype (San Francisco), Mok is the founder of two successful products companies: CMCD (publisher of the award-winning Visual Symbol Library, a collection of royalty-free photographs and spot animations) and NetObjects (one of Fortune magazine's “25 Coolest Technology Companies in 1996”). Formerly creative director at Apple Computer, he has published internationally and has received hundreds of awards in many industry categories. He is a charter board member of the New Media Centers and the author of Designing Business: Multiple Media, Multiple Disciplines from Adobe Press, a book about applying design and business principles in the context of digital media.
